GE® MWF PHARMACEUTICAL REFRIGERATOR WATER FILTER

 

FEATURES

Max. Filtered Water Flow (gpm)0.5 
Filter Life6 Months 
Filter MediaCarbon Block 
Operation Water Pressure (psi)40 min. - 120 max. 
NSF 42Yes 
NSF 53Yes 
Pharmaceutical Filtration - Claims tested/verified by independent laboratory, not certified by NSF International or state of CAYes 
State of CA CertifiedYes 
Asbestos Reduction>99% 
Atrazine (Herbicide) Reduction94.5% 
Benzene Reduction96.7% 
Chlorine Taste and Odor Reduction97.5% 
Cysts Reduction99.99% 
Lead Reduction99.3% @ 6.5 pH and 99.3% @ 8.5 pH 
Lindane Reduction (A Pesticide)99% 
Mercury Reduction93.2% @ 6.5 pH and 93.2% @ 8.5 pH 
Nominal Particulant class 199.7% 
P-Dichlorobenzene Reduction99.8% 
Tetrachloroethylene96.7% 
Toxaphene Reduction93.2% 
Atenolol99.5% 
Endrin97.1% 
Fluoxetine99.4% 
Ibuprofen94.1% 
Progesterone99.5% 
Trimethoprim99.5%

FEATURES

  • Information below refers to an improved MWF filter, available after September 3, 2013. Details about the previous MWF model can be found at GEAppliances.com/service_and_support/literature
  • Exclusive advanced filtration
  • Tested and verified to filter 5 trace pharmaceuticals including ibuprofen, progesterone, atenolol, trimethoprim, and fluoxetine* (* The contaminants or other substances removed or reduced by this water filter are not necessarily in all users’ water)
  • NSF certified to filter contaminants such as cysts, lead, mercury, asbestos, and select pesticides and chemicals
  • NSF certified for structural performance and to filter chlorine taste and odor and particulates
  • Designed and tested specifically for use in select side-by-side and bottom-freezer refrigerators
  • Easy tool-free replacement
  • Certified genuine GE Part
  • Replace every six months** (** Cartridge should be replaced every 6 months at rated capacity, or sooner if a noticeable reduction in flow rate occurs)
